UEFA European Under-21 Championship

52 of the UEFA member associations will participated in the 2015 UEFA European Under-21 Championship to seek qualification for the finals. Being the hosts, Czech Republic automatically qualifies. The 2015 UEFA European Under-21 Championship comprises a qualifying group stage and play-off round to determine which 7 teams will join Czech Republic in the final tournament.

Qualifying[]

From March 2013 to September 2014. Teams are split into ten groups – two of 6 teams and eight of 5 teams – and play each other on a home and away basis. The results against the 6th-placed teams are ignored. The 10 group winners and 4 group runners-up with the best record advance to the play-offs.

Play-offs[]

October 2014. The play-offs consist of 7 contests - the 10 group winners and 4 best runners-up. Each team play their opponent home and away.

Final[]

June 2015. The final tournament comprises the 7 play-off winners and the Czech Republic as hosts. The 8 teams are split into 2 groups of four. Each team plays each other once in their group with the winners and runners-up advancing to the semi-finals.
